muster
verb: If you muster something such as support, strength, or energy, you gather as much of it as you can in order to do something. verb: When soldiers muster or are mustered, they gather together in one place in order to take part in a military action. muster in American English to assemble or summon (troops, etc.), as for inspection, roll call, or service intransitive verb: to assemble for inspection, service, etc., as troops or forces transitive verb: to assemble (troops, a ship's crew, etc.), as for battle, display, inspection, orders, or discharge muster in British English verb: to call together (numbers of men) for duty, inspection, etc, or (of men) to assemble in this way |
